Two women in their 80s, man in his 50s injured in Highway 4 crash near Hefer Junction

The Zioneer Intelligence Desk

Primary source Internal intake · 2 reviewed intake signals · Desk window 10:51

TL;DR

A serious traffic accident between two vehicles on Highway 4 near Hefer Junction left an 80-year-old woman with a severe head injury and a woman in her 80s and a man in his 50s moderately injured, according to Magen David Adom (MDA). MDA medic Idan Shina, who treated the victims, said one vehicle overturned and firefighters performed a complex extraction before evacuating all three to Hillel Yaffe Medical Center in Hadera.
